I was driving on the 401 last summer and there was a decked out(we are talking rack,bars,lights,ladder,you name it) Discovery a couple of vehicles ahead of me.Of coarse I made it a point to end up at his back door,and noticed the "TDI" badge.When he pulled into a service station,I followed him and kinda got his attention by hollering "how did you get your hands on a diesel?!",he looked over at me and hollered back with a greasy grin,"don't ask!".We stood by our trucks and talked for a solid hour(I did most of the talking..begging to buy it!)and he explained that he was able to get the truck imported into Canada through Diplomatic means,but it could not change hands for the next ten or twelve years,and would have to remain property of the British Government until then.It was a pretty interesting story to say the least,but I did happen to get the Guys phone number which I'll start calling.....in ten to twelve years! Oh yeah,this Disco was "made to order" as well, premium two tone leather(the really good stuff),burl wood shift *****,and lots of exclusive interior trim goodies,plus the "Special Vehicles" ID plate on the rad support.It must have cost a fortune when it was new. So,to answer your question,yes Diesel's are good!
